Web4 de jul. de 2024 · The Affinity Federal Credit Union HSA account has no minimum deposit requirement and charges no HSA fees. It offers a debit card with the account, but no checking privileges are indicated. The account currently pays 0.25% APY and you can fund it with direct deposits.
WebBank of America makes available The HSA for Life® Health Savings Account as a custodian only. The HSA for Life is intended to qualify as a Health Savings Account as set forth in Internal Revenue Code Section 223. However, the account beneficiary that establishes the HSA is solely responsible for ensuring that he/she satisfies the Health ...
